1992 Pontiac Formula Firehawk, a Hot Rod by SLP

By Matthew Lynch
January 15, 2024
0
Spread the love

Intro:

The 1992 Pontiac Formula Firehawk is a truly iconic American muscle car that has captured the hearts of automotive enthusiasts for decades. The limited-production, high-performance variant of the Pontiac Firebird formula took the already-impressive base model and transformed it into a hot rod engineered by Street Legal Performance (SLP). In this article, we will dive deep into the history, design, and performance of this classic creation.

A bit of history:

The partnership between Pontiac and SLP first began in 1991 when the latter introduced its first-ever Firehawk, developed as a special limited-production performance package for the V8-powered Pontiac Firebird. The exceptional reception from customers inspired SLP to take their creation even further, culminating in the birth of the 1992 Formula Firehawk.

Exterior and design:

Retaining much of the aggressive aesthetic for which American muscle cars are known, the 1992 Firehawk features streamlined bodywork with a domed hood, quad headlamps, tightly sculpted side profiles, and a bold rear spoiler that accentuate its commanding presence on the road. In addition to its striking appearance, major design upgrades include a functional hood scoop and distinctive “Firehawk” badging.

Engine and performance:

At its core lies a potent 5.7-liter (350 cu in) LT1 V8 engine capable of producing a staggering 350 horsepower and 350 lb-ft of torque. This impressive power plant is mated to either a six-speed manual or four-speed automatic transmission. With its meticulously tuned suspension system designed to optimize ride comfort and performance handling capabilities, it’s no wonder that enthusiasts consider the Firehawk a premier track weapon.

SLP’s enhancements to this fiery beast didn’t stop with just sheer power; they went above and beyond to focus on crafting a genuinely unique driving experience. The Firehawk benefited from an upgraded suspension system with custom-valved Bilstein shocks, progressive-rate springs, and beefier sway bars. In addition, aftermarket features such as lightweight alloy wheels wrapped in high-performance tires maximized traction and grip, while larger disc brakes ensured increased stopping power.

Limited production:

One of the most intriguing aspects of the 1992 Pontiac Formula Firehawk is its rarity. With only 25 units ever built, car enthusiasts and collectors alike continue to cherish these vehicles, which often fetch a considerable sum when they surface in the market.

Conclusion:

The 1992 Pontiac Formula Firehawk is more than just a performance-enhanced version of a beloved classic; it’s evidence of the seamless collaboration between Pontiac and SLP, resulting in an incredibly powerful and sought-after muscle car. From its aggressive styling to its exceptional performance capabilities, the Formula Firehawk stands as a testament to American automotive ingenuity and is a proud piece of hot rod history.
